Output 5609c57a9e94de82223e339f42e382fd25cb289e5327deaa25fceb1f9c41cb6d:2

value
12040800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a05364b0bb1aa6d0506a752c2c3d44dbc404c666 OP_EQUAL
address
3GJjwWK5ytqg44wzPqoGRmhviP1CoxB9Jk
transaction
5609c57a9e94de82223e339f42e382fd25cb289e5327deaa25fceb1f9c41cb6d
confirmations
299981
spent
true